What is the podcast about Robert Hanssen? Where did Robert Hanssen go to church? – From 1979 through 2001, Robert Philip Hanssen was an American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) agent who spied for Soviet and Russian intelligence services against the United States.

He was born on April 18, 1944, and passed away on June 5, 2023, at the age of 79.

Three years after joining the FBI, Hanssen approached the Soviet Main Intelligence Directorate (GRU) and offered his services, kicking off his first espionage cycle that lasted until 1981.

He resumed his espionage activities in 1985 and continued until 1991 when he cut off connections during the Soviet Union’s demise for fear of being revealed.

He remained unidentified to the Soviets during his surveillance.

The Department of Justice called his spying “possibly the worst intelligence disaster in U.S. history.”

What is the podcast about Robert Hanssen?

The podcast GRAY SUIT & THE GHOST discusses the search for Robert Hanssen.

Hayley Atwell explains the hunt for infamous FBI mole Robert Hanssen with Eric O’Neill, the man tasked with arresting him, in the podcast.

Eric O’Neill is a SPYEX consultant and former FBI counter-terrorism and investigation specialist. He was a key figure in the arrest, conviction, and imprisonment.

Where did Robert Hanssen go to church?

Robert Hanssen attended Opus Dei Church. Surprisingly, he was quite punctual and active in Opus Dei’s operations.

Hanssen has been attending a 6:30 a.m. daily Mass for over a decade, according to an Oakcrest priest.

C. John McCloskey, an Opus Dei member, claimed he also periodically attended the daily noontime Mass at the Catholic Information Center in downtown Washington, D.C.
